A chopped cheese sandwich is a type of deli sandwich that originated in New York City in the 1970s. It is made with ground beef, cheese, and onions, and is typically served on a hero roll. The sandwich is popular in bodegas and delis throughout the city, and has become a staple of New York City cuisine.

The chopped cheese sandwich is made by first browning ground beef in a pan. Once the beef is cooked, it is chopped into small pieces. The cheese is then added to the pan and melted. Onions are also added to the pan and cooked until they are softened. The beef, cheese, and onions are then combined and placed on a hero roll. The sandwich can be served with additional toppings, such as lettuce, tomato, and pickles.
